What is a QA Engineer at Myntra?

As a QA Engineer at Myntra, you sit at the heart of one of India’s leading fashion and lifestyle e-commerce platforms. Your work directly ensures the reliability and seamless performance of a high-scale ecosystem that processes millions of transactions, personalized recommendations, and complex supply chain operations. You are not just testing features; you are safeguarding the user experience for millions of customers who rely on the platform’s stability during high-traffic events like the End of Reason Sale (EORS).

This role requires a blend of rigorous technical precision and a deep understanding of the retail domain. You will be responsible for designing robust automation frameworks, identifying critical edge cases, and collaborating closely with developers and product managers to uphold the high quality standards synonymous with Myntra. It is a challenging, fast-paced environment where your ability to think critically about complex systems directly impacts the business’s bottom line and customer trust.

Key Responsibilities

As a QA Engineer, you will primarily focus on ensuring the quality of Myntra’s customer-facing applications. You will be responsible for creating and maintaining automated test suites that cover critical user journeys, such as checkout, payment processing, and product discovery. You will work closely with developers to identify bottlenecks early in the development cycle, shifting left on quality.

Beyond automation, you will act as a guardian of the user experience. You will participate in sprint planning, conduct manual exploratory testing when necessary, and analyze production logs to identify recurring issues. Your ability to communicate quality risks to stakeholders is as important as your technical output, as you will often be the final gatekeeper before a feature reaches the production environment.

Role Requirements & Qualifications

A successful candidate for QA Engineer at Myntra typically possesses a strong foundation in computer science and a track record of building automated testing solutions.

  • Must-have skills – Proficiency in Java, deep experience with Selenium WebDriver, strong SQL query writing skills, and a solid grasp of SDLC/STLC processes.
  • Nice-to-have skills – Experience with API testing (RestAssured), familiarity with cloud infrastructure (AWS), and hands-on experience with mobile automation (Appium).
  • Experience level – Typically 2–5 years of experience in a product-based company is preferred.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: How difficult are the technical rounds at Myntra? A: The difficulty is considered high. Interviewers often challenge your assumptions and may push you to explain the internal workings of the tools you use, not just how to use them.

Q: What is the best way to prepare for the coding rounds? A: Focus on array-based problems and basic string manipulation. Practice writing code on a whiteboard or a simple text editor rather than an IDE to simulate the interview environment.

Q: How should I handle an interviewer who seems difficult or dismissive? A: Maintain your professional composure. Some interviewers may adopt a challenging stance to test your resilience under pressure. Focus on the problem, stay calm, and continue to communicate your thought process clearly.

Q: Is it common to have multiple rounds in one day? A: Yes, it is common for the interview process to be condensed into a single day or a tight window. Ensure you are prepared for a long, high-intensity day of back-to-back sessions.

Other General Tips

  • Follow up effectively: If you are waiting for an update, reach out to your recruiter professionally. Persistence is viewed as a sign of interest, provided it is not excessive.
  • Know your resume inside out: Be ready to explain every single tool and technology listed on your resume in extreme detail. If you mention a project, be prepared to discuss its architecture and your specific contribution.
  • Prioritize communication: Even if you get stuck on a coding problem, explain your logic. Interviewers often value the approach more than the final, perfect code.
  • Prepare for the "Retail" context: Familiarize yourself with the e-commerce domain. Understanding concepts like cart abandonment, payment gateway flows, and inventory management can give you a significant edge.
